Key Takeaways Protease cleavage failure is common: Even well-designed constructs frequently show incomplete or absent tag removal Steric hindrance is the #1 cause: Cleavage sites too close to structured regions are inaccessible Non-specific cleavage is a hidden problem: Proteases like thrombin can damage your protein at unexpected sites Protease choice matters: TEV, HRV3C, thrombin, and SUMO protease have different strengths and limitations Incomplete cleavage creates purification nightmares: Separating cleaved from uncleaved protein is often harder than the original purification The Tag Removal Challenge Why We Use Tags Affinity tags revolutionized protein purification: His-tag: Simple, universal, small GST: Improves solubility, large but easy to remove MBP: Excellent solubility enhancement SUMO: Enhances folding, clean removal Strep-tag: Mild elution conditions Without tags, purification requires protein-specific method development
